Illinois Skunk by Nikko Genetics

Unknown

Illinois Skunk, bred by Nikko Genetics, is a hybrid strain celebrated for its unique genetic blend and robust profile. It offers a balanced experience, drawing from both classic skunk heritage and modern indica and sativa influences. This strain is appreciated for its distinct aroma, flavor, and versatile effects.

Appearance

Illinois Skunk buds are notable for their dense structure and generous coating of resin, indicating high quality and potency. They typically display a vibrant mix of green hues, often accented by deep purple undertones and orange pistils. A frosty layer of trichomes covers the flowers, giving them a crystalline appearance.

Aroma & Flavor

The aroma of Illinois Skunk is characterized by a strong, pungent skunky scent, characteristic of its lineage. This is complemented by underlying notes of earth, citrus, and herbal undertones. Upon consumption, the flavor follows a similar profile, starting with a bold skunky taste that evolves into earthy and herbal notes, often with a subtle sweetness and a lingering aftertaste.

Effects

Illinois Skunk provides a balanced experience, often described as both calming and cerebral. Users may feel relaxed while also experiencing mental clarity. This hybrid nature makes it suitable for various times of day, offering a versatile effect profile that can be enjoyed both recreationally and for its potential therapeutic benefits.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ids

This strain typically contains THC levels ranging from 18% to 22%, with minimal CBD (<1%). Key terpenes identified include Myrcene, which contributes earthy notes, Limonene, adding citrus hints, and Caryophyllene, providing a peppery spice. These compounds work together to shape the strain's aroma, flavor, and effects, potentially contributing to the entourage effect.

Origins & Lineage

Bred by Nikko Genetics, Illinois Skunk is a hybrid strain that draws from classic skunk genetics while integrating modern indica and sativa characteristics. Its lineage is noted for blending these traits in harmony, resulting in a balanced genetic profile that offers the best attributes of both plant types. It is often compared to historic Skunk #1 but with its own distinct heritage.
